Royal Naval Engineering College (RNEC) was a principal technical training establishment for engineering officers of the Royal Navy from the late 19th century until the late 20th century. Located at Keyham near Plymouth and earlier at Greenwich, it educated cadets and artificers in naval architecture, marine engineering, electrical engineering and later electronics.
